The B2B Foil Balloon Printing Process Comparison Matrix

Printing Process Color Saturation Registration Accuracy Abrasion Resistance Standard MOQ Relative Setup Cost Best B2B Sourcing Fit
Rotogravure Printing ★★★★★ (Outstanding) ±0.05mm (Micron-Level) [58] ★★★★★ (Superior) [62] 3,000+ units [59] High (Cylinder fees apply) [73] High-volume retail programs, licensed IP cartoon characters [59]
Silkscreen Printing ★★★★☆ (High) [59] ±0.2mm to ±0.3mm [59] ★★★★☆ (Very Stable) [59] 500 - 1,000 units [59] Low (Screen charge only) [64] Simple corporate logos, mono-color or dual-color text branding [59, 64]
Digital UV Printing ★★★☆☆ (Moderate) [59] ±0.3mm to ±0.5mm [59] ★★☆☆☆ (Brittle Surface) [59] 1 - 100 units [59] None (No plates required) [66] Bespoke samples, low-MOQ event test-marketing [66]
Heat Transfer ★★★☆☆ (Variable) [60] ±0.5mm+ (Poor) [60] ★★☆☆☆ (Delamination risk) [60] 500+ units [60] Moderate [60] Not Recommended: High temperature ruptures polymer gas-barrier [60, 69]

Rotogravure Printing: Why It Is the Premium Choice for Volume Brands

Rotogravure printing is the undisputed gold standard for manufacturing high-fidelity custom printed mylar balloons [60, 61]. The process utilizes direct-transfer steel cylinders [61]. Each color in the design is high-speed engraved onto a dedicated steel roll using high-precision diamond-tipped styluses or chemical etching systems [23]. During operation, the composite aluminum-polyamide film web runs through the press, picking up ink directly from the micro-recesses of the engraved steel rolls [61].

For multinational brand accounts and licensed IP developers, rotogravure presents massive engineering advantages:

  • Micron-Level Registration Accuracy: Our automatic high-speed rotogravure presses are equipped with computerized photoelectric tracking sensors [62]. This system monitors registration marks in real-time, holding overprint tolerances within a strict ±0.05mm [62]. This prevents any ink overlap, white gaps, or ghosting along the edges of complex patterns.
  • Unparalleled Color Gradation: The high ink transfer efficiency allows gravure to reproduce delicate gradients, fine photorealistic textures, and depth transitions that are impossible to achieve via traditional screen methods [62].
  • Exceptional Durability and Abrasion Resistance: The liquid ink is chemically bonded directly onto the biaxially-oriented Nylon (BOPA) surface [62]. Under high-frequency weld temperatures, the printed pattern integrates fully with the film substrate, remaining intact through repeated inflation, folding, packing, and transit [62].
Chemical Safety: Benzene-Free and Ketone-Free Water-Based Inks

A major hazard in cheap balloon importing is the chemical residue of aromatic solvents. Low-tier workshops utilize solvent inks containing harmful benzene and ketones, which easily fail import toxicology screens. Silkscreen Printing: Cost-Effective Solution for Simple B2B Branding

For promotional event decorations, wholesale party bouquets, and corporate branding programs consisting of simple single-color or dual-color solid graphics, silkscreen printing represents an incredibly cost-effective sourcing path [64]. The process presses thick, viscous ink through pre-exposed mesh screens directly onto the un-welded film substrate [64].

The core B2B benefits of silkscreen printing include:

  • Reduced Upfront Capital Outlay: Screen preparation charges are extremely low compared to the high mechanical engraving cost of rotogravure steel cylinders [64, 73].
  • Flexible Minimum Order Quantities: silkescreen allows B2B buyers to initiate custom printed balloon orders with small batches ranging between 500 and 1,000 units per SKU, lowering initial test-marketing risks [64].
  • High Ink Film Thickness: Silkscreen yields an exceptionally thick ink layer, providing high opacity and solid color saturation on darker metallic films, especially for solid white or gold corporate branding.

However, the process holds clear limits [65]. Silkscreen cannot reproduce complex photographic details, half-tones, or delicate gradients [65]. Furthermore, overprint registration accuracy is typically limited to ±0.2mm to ±0.3mm [65]. If your brand logo relies on intricate color overlays, silkscreen will cause noticeable registration errors [65].

Digital UV Printing: The Flexible Path for Samples and Ultra-Low Batches

For marketing agencies executing tight local campaigns, or cross-border sellers testing new cartoon IP designs on Amazon EU [51], Digital UV printing offers excellent setup flexibility [66]. Because it operates like a high-precision digital inkjet plotter, UV printing bypasses plates or screens entirely, enabling order processing with no minimum order quantity (Low MOQ) [66].

However, UV printing has a critical physical weakness for foil balloons: the ink is cured instantly under ultraviolet lamps, forming a rigid polymer film on the surface [67]. Because high-barrier Nylon/PE film expands and contracts under helium gas pressures, this rigid cured ink layer is highly prone to micro-cracking and flaking [67].

Therefore, UV printing is primarily reserved for pre-production samples, prototype proofing, and short-term indoor corporate parties [68]. For balloons intended for retail packaging, global shipping networks, or long-term warehouse storage, rotogravure remains the only viable process [68].

Thermal Heat Transfer: Why Industrial Balloon Factories Avoid This Process

Some secondary trading agents and small-scale domestic shops pitch heat transfer printing as a low-cost full-color solution [60, 69]. The process uses heat and pressure to transfer pre-printed film graphics directly onto the balloon substrate [69].

FAIR's engineering team strongly advises B2B buyers to avoid this decoration method for high-performance mylar foil balloons due to severe physical compatibility issues:

Polymer Engineering Warning: Micro-Pinhole Delamination

Composite balloon films (like BOPA/PE or BOPET/PE) are highly sensitive to thermal spikes [69]. The high temperature (150 to 180 degrees Celsius) and concentrated mechanical press required during heat transfer can melt the delicate low-density polyethylene (LDPE) inner sealant layer [69]. This creates micro-voids, bubbles, and pinholes along the seam boundaries [69]. Once inflated with high-pressure helium gas, these micro-voids become permanent gas-migration points, drastically reducing your float times from 15 days down to less than 24 hours [69, 70].
